If y tends to decrease linearly as x increases. the variables are -------linearly correlated.

Short Answer

Expert verified

The variables are Negatively linearly correlated.

Explanation

When the value of yfalls as the value of xrises, the two are said to be negatively linked.

As a result, the variables are negatively linearly connected if ytends to drop linearly as xgrows.
